Wow! What a Farm!!! This property includes 160 acres. A restored turn of the century 2 story farm house, 3 stocked fishing ponds, equipment shed and entertainment shed. All located 1 1/2 mile's off of 400 Hwy between Piedmont and Severy Ks. The home is completely remodeled period era with an updated kitchen that includes all appliances and washer & dryer. The home has central heat/air. It is the perfect get away property, cabin or company... more
